Leonards Cove – Dartmouth, North Devon
This has to be one of the best locations in Dartmouth and the park has outstanding views along the coast and with some superb beaches nearby you can make the most of this area and enjoy exploring and having fun. The Leonards Cove park has a variety of log cabin accommodation and cottages and with excellent sports and leisure facilities nearby, superb restaurants and bars and a range of shops and places to explore you have everything to hand and where you need it. Not only this but you are also within easy reach of the other wonderful seaside towns that are easy to get to from here including Paignton, Torquay and Torbay (to name just a few). The park has an superb selection of log cabin accommodation and the largest can sleep upwards of eight people, so plenty of room for families and friends to enjoy. The facilities will attract anyone and the indoor and the outdoor heated swimming pools are the highlights, but you can also take advantage of the tennis courts, five aside football, pool tables and the spa and sauna facilities that are available. Prices range from just £220.00 for a week away, so excellent value, excellent accommodation and excellent facilities.

This is another luxury log cabin retreat in the heart of South Devon. The Indio Lake log cabin accommodation is second to none and with a wide selection that sleep from 2 to 4 people this is a quiet and relaxed secluded log cabin park. You are perfectly placed to both enjoy the fun of the beach and the beauty of the surrounding countryside including the Dartmoor National Park and this is why this park is one of the most popular in South Devon. The park is in peaceful woodlands and the log cabins are perfectly placed to give you the privacy that you want from a holiday or short break and you are only a short drive from everything that Devon has to offer.
